Physical
Optical
- Optical type
- Biaxial (+) · 2V measured = 60° · 2V calc = 59.1°
- Refractive index
- 1.647 – 1.685
- Surface relief
- High
- Principal indices
- nα 1.647 · nβ 1.656 · nγ 1.685
- Pleochroism
- Non-pleochroic
- Dispersion
- slight, r< v

Crystallography
- Space group
- C2/c
- Cell parameters
- a = 12.470(9) Å · b = 12.554(9) Å · c = 6.848(9) Å
- Cell angles
- β = 113.75(2) °
- Ratio a:b:c
- 1 : 1.007 : 0.549
